They were both sung as group numbers by New Directions members of … WebThis McDonald’s Australia ad song is a tune titled ‘Livin’ On A Prayer’ that’s performed by the American glam metal rock band Bon Jovi. Taken from the New Jersey group’s third studio album ‘Slippery When Wet’, this commercial song was released in 1986, reached number 3 on the Australian singles charts and has since become a ...
